

· By Gabby Yan
Bali Street Food: A Complete Guide to Culinary Delights
Key Takeaways
-
Bali street food is bold, cheap, and everywhere. Think smoky satay, fried rice, and tropical desserts for under $2.
-
Top dishes to try: Nasi goreng, satay lilit, babi guling, bakso, martabak, and es campur.
-
Vegan-friendly faves: Gado-gado, pisang goreng, tempeh goreng, sayur urab, and black rice pudding.
-
Best spots? Ubud for variety, Kuta for late-night eats, Jimbaran for seafood, Seminyak for stylish bites.
-
Pro tip: Eat where it’s busy, bring reusable containers, and always say “terima kasih.”
Bali isn’t just about dreamy beaches and iconic rice terraces. It’s a paradise for your taste buds, too. Did you know that over 80% of tourists in Bali rank its food as one of the top reasons they visit? And no, we’re not just talking about the fancy cafés with avocado toast. Street food is where Bali’s culinary magic truly happens.
Imagine this: the smoky aroma of satay sizzling on a charcoal grill, the clatter of woks tossing fried noodles, and vendors yelling “Bakso!” like a delicious battle cry. It’s chaotic, mouthwatering, and authentic. Whether you’re devouring crispy martabak under the stars or slurping a warm bowl of bakso after a long day, Bali’s street food scene offers more than just food. It’s a window into the heart of the island.
But here’s the catch: not all stalls are created equal. Choose wisely, and you’re in for a treat. Choose poorly, and, well, let’s just say you might get to know your hotel bathroom a little too well. That’s why we’ve crafted this guide. By the time you finish reading, you’ll not only know what to eat but where to eat it, and how to do it like a pro. Let’s dig in!
Why Try Bali Street Food?
Let’s get straight to the point: Bali street food is a flavor bomb you didn’t know you needed in your life. Think of it as a delicious crash course in Balinese culture. It’s bold, spicy, savory, sweet, sometimes all in the same bite.
For the budget-conscious traveler (a.k.a. those saving rupiah for that dreamy Ubud villa), street food is a blessing. A plate of nasi goreng for less than a latte back home? Yes, please. Plus, there’s something magical about pulling up a plastic chair next to locals and digging in. It’s the kind of authenticity Instagram filters can’t fake.
Bali’s street food isn’t just about eating. It’s about diving headfirst into the soul of the island. It’s a hands-on, senses-on experience that connects you with the traditions and flavors of local life. If you want to see the real Bali, you’ll find it in the smoky corners of a night market or in a humble warung where the owner knows every customer by name.
Street food is also the epitome of sustainability in its simplest form. Most vendors use local, seasonal ingredients, no fancy shmancy imports or unnecessary packaging here. What you eat has often traveled fewer miles than you did to get to Bali. Supporting these small, family-run businesses not only gives you a taste of authentic Bali but also contributes to the local economy in a meaningful way. Food that tastes good and does good? That’s a win-win.
6 Popular Bali Street Food Dishes
When it comes to Bali street food, the variety is overwhelming (in the best way). Here’s what you shouldn’t miss for the world.
1. Nasi Goreng
This isn’t just fried rice. It’s a rich, smoky dish elevated by kecap manis (sweet soy sauce), sambal, and a medley of toppings like fried shallots, crispy crackers, and even grilled prawns. Many stalls cook it over high heat with traditional woks, giving it that “wok hei” flavor. A charred, smoky essence that’s the mark of a great cook.
2. Satay Lilit
Satay lilit is a sustainable snack hero. Instead of using wooden skewers, the minced fish mixture is wrapped around lemongrass stalks, which not only imparts flavor but also eliminates waste. It’s spiced with lime leaves, turmeric, and a hint of coconut, giving it a vibrant, zesty taste that screams Bali.
3. Babi Guling (Suckling Pig)
If you’re a meat lover, this dish is non-negotiable. The pork is slow-roasted until the skin is crispy perfection, while the meat underneath stays tender and juicy. It’s seasoned with a mix of turmeric, lemongrass, garlic, and other spices. While it’s a feast for the taste buds, many vendors also focus on using free-range pigs sourced from local farmers, ensuring a more sustainable approach to meat production.
4. Bakso
Bakso vendors often serve their meatball soup in eco-friendly bowls made from banana leaves. This is fast food, Bali-style, which is hearty, filling, and often paired with crispy fried wontons or a boiled egg. Keep an eye out for vendors with steaming carts; the homemade broth is what makes the difference.
5. Martabak
The dough for martabak is handmade daily, and watching a vendor roll, stretch, and fry it is half the fun. For a sustainable twist, some stalls are now offering fillings with locally grown fruits, such as banana and jackfruit, alongside the more indulgent chocolate or cheese options.
6. Es Campur (Mixed Ice Dessert)
What better way to cool down than with a kaleidoscope of tropical flavors? Es campur often features coconut milk, palm sugar syrup, and fresh fruits like mango, dragon fruit, and jackfruit. Bonus: Many vendors are now switching to compostable cups and bamboo spoons to reduce plastic waste.
5 Vegan or Vegetarian-Friendly Bali Street Food Dishes
Oh, don’t worry, you! I haven’t forgotten about you either.
Bali’s street food scene isn’t just a paradise for meat lovers. It’s equally rewarding for vegans and vegetarians. With a focus on fresh, local ingredients and vibrant flavors, plant-based travelers will find plenty of delicious options that are both satisfying and sustainable.
1. Gado-Gado
Think of gado-gado as a salad, but make it Bali-style. It’s a colorful mix of boiled vegetables, tofu, and tempeh (fermented soybeans), all smothered in a rich, slightly spicy peanut sauce. Many vendors serve it with crispy crackers made from cassava, which are often vegan. Bonus: Gado-gado is a zero-waste champion, as the ingredients are usually sourced fresh from local markets and served on banana leaves.
2. Pisang Goreng (Fried Banana)
A sweet snack that’s naturally vegan and utterly irresistible. These golden, crispy bananas are fried in a light batter and often drizzled with palm sugar syrup or sprinkled with shredded coconut. It’s a guilt-free treat that also supports local banana farmers. Look for street stalls with sizzling woks, and you’re bound to find this delicacy.
3. Sayur Urab (Balinese Vegetable Salad)
A traditional Balinese dish that’s packed with flavor and nutrition. Sayur urab combines steamed vegetables like long beans, spinach, and bean sprouts with grated coconut and a spice paste made from garlic, chili, and lime leaves. It’s a perfect vegan side dish or snack, often served in banana leaf bowls for an eco-friendly touch.
4. Tempeh Goreng (Fried Tempeh)
Bali’s ultimate plant-based protein snack. Tempeh, made from fermented soybeans, is sliced thin, marinated in a blend of spices, and fried until golden and crispy. You’ll find it sold as a snack, a side dish, or even a protein-rich topping for rice dishes. It’s savory, satisfying, and perfect for munching on the go. Many vendors also use locally made tempeh, supporting Bali’s small-scale producers.
5. Bubur Injin (Black Rice Pudding)
This traditional dessert is not only vegan but also incredibly comforting. Bubur injin is made from black sticky rice, slowly cooked with coconut milk and palm sugar until it becomes thick and creamy. It’s served warm or cold, often topped with extra coconut cream. It’s a street food staple that doubles as a sweet treat after a savory meal.
Best Places to Find Bali Street Food
Bali’s street food scene varies by location, so here’s an expanded guide to finding the best bites.
Seminyak
Known for its upscale vibe, Seminyak’s night markets are perfect for foodies who want flavor with a touch of flair. Visit Pasar Senggol for trendy takes on traditional street food.
Ubud
Duh. But I still wanted to include it, as there is a sea of options here.
The cultural heart of Bali also serves up some of the island’s best street food. Head to Gianyar Night Market for authentic dishes like babi guling or lawar (a traditional Balinese salad).
Kuta
Loud, lively, and packed with street vendors. Kuta is ideal for post-surf snacking. Try the bakso carts along the main strip for a quick and satisfying meal.
Jimbaran
Seafood lovers, this is your paradise. Visit the Jimbaran Bay area for freshly grilled fish and prawns seasoned with locally sourced spices.
Supporting street vendors in these areas isn’t just about indulging your cravings. It’s about contributing to a food culture that’s deeply rooted in community and sustainability.
How to Choose Safe and Delicious Street Food
Street food is Bali’s unsung hero, but not all heroes wear capes or follow strict hygiene standards. Stay adventurous yet cautious with these tips.
Crowds Speak Volumes
Go where the locals go. Busy stalls mean high turnover, ensuring freshness.
Watch Them Cook
Vendors who prepare food on the spot are your safest bet. Hot food = fewer bacteria.
Avoid Single-Use Plastics
Bring your own reusable utensils and napkins. Many vendors will happily accommodate your request.
Choose Sustainable Stalls
Some vendors now promote eco-friendly practices, like using banana leaves instead of Styrofoam. Seek them out!
Cultural Insights into Balinese Street Food
Food is central to Balinese culture, reflecting the island’s traditions, religious beliefs, and community-oriented way of life. Most dishes you’ll find at street stalls are deeply symbolic. For instance, lawar is a dish often prepared for ceremonies, symbolizing balance in life through its mix of flavors and textures.
Balinese street food is also a showcase of “gotong royong,” the spirit of cooperation. Many vendors work in close-knit networks, sourcing ingredients locally and often collaborating on recipes. By supporting these small businesses, you’re helping sustain this unique culinary ecosystem.
Street food in Bali isn’t just about eating; it’s a tradition. From ceremonies to daily meals, food plays a starring role in Balinese culture. Ever notice how perfectly balanced the flavors are? That’s not an accident. Balinese cuisine follows the concept of “Rwa Bhineda,” the balance of opposites, where spicy, sweet, sour, salty, and bitter all coexist harmoniously.
Even the way food is prepared reflects community spirit. Many street food vendors use recipes passed down through generations, often as family secrets. So when you’re enjoying a plate of fried noodles, you’re not just eating, you’re tasting history.
Must-Try Warungs (Local Eateries)
Warungs are where you’ll find Bali’s heart and soul, along with some of its best food. These small, family-run eateries are often committed to sustainability in ways large and small.
Warung Nasi Ayam Ibu Oki (Jimbaran): Famous for its no-waste practices, serving all parts of the chicken in its nasi ayam.
Warung Babi Guling Ibu Oka (Ubud): A legend for its suckling pig. Their focus on local farms ensures fresh, sustainable pork.
Warung Satria (Denpasar): A satay lover’s dream, with most ingredients sourced from nearby farms.
Street Food Etiquette and Tips
Here are a few extra tips to ensure you’re a respectful and sustainable street food traveler.
Bring Your Own Container: Avoid plastic waste by carrying a reusable container for takeout orders.
Eat Mindfully: Order only what you can finish. Food waste isn’t just wasteful. It’s disrespectful to the vendors who work hard to prepare it.
Support Vendors Who Go Green: Some stalls now display signs highlighting sustainable practices. Give them your business to encourage this trend.
When enjoying street food in Bali, remember a few simple courtesies to enhance your experience and show respect for the vendors. Avoid haggling aggressively. Prices are already incredibly low, and a few extra rupiah go a long way in supporting these hardworking locals. Embrace the communal vibe by sharing tables with fellow diners; it’s a great way to immerse yourself in the culture and maybe even spark a conversation. Finally, always say “terima kasih” (thank you) after your meal. It’s a small gesture that goes a long way in showing appreciation for the delicious food and the warm service.
Best Times to Explore Bali’s Street Food Scene
Timing your street food adventures can make all the difference. Mornings are best for traditional snacks like jajan pasar (market cakes) and strong Balinese coffee. Evenings, however, are when Bali truly comes alive. Head to night markets like Sanur or Gianyar after sunset for the full sensory overload, bright lights, sizzling woks, and the hum of a lively crowd.
If you’re lucky enough to visit during a festival, don’t miss the chance to sample ceremonial street food like bubur injin (black rice pudding). Festivals often bring out special dishes you won’t find any other time.
Conclusion
Street food isn’t just a meal in Bali; it’s an adventure, a story, and a chance to connect with the island in the most delicious way possible. It’s in the smoky corners of night markets, the bustling warungs with their handwritten menus, and the warm smiles of vendors serving recipes passed down for generations.
By now, you’ve got a solid plan. Hunt down that perfect plate of nasi goreng, brave the heat for a freshly grilled satay lilit, and cool off with an absurdly colorful bowl of es campur. Don’t be afraid to get a little messy. Food tastes better when you’re leaning over a plastic table, doesn’t it?
So, what are you waiting for? Pack your curiosity, an empty stomach, and maybe some hand sanitizer (just in case). Bali’s street food scene is calling, and trust us, it’s not leaving you on read. Go out there, eat like a local, and make every bite count. Your taste buds will thank you, and so will your Instagram.
Bon appétit, or as they say in Bali, “Selamat makan!”
Hungry for more than just street food? Our Bali Travel E-Guide is packed with local tips, hidden food gems, and curated itineraries to help you eat (and explore) like a true insider.
Share:
Psst!! Don't miss out on our other posts
-
Indonesia’s Local Languages: A Guide to Its Linguistic Diversity
Discover Indonesia’s 700+ languages, from Bahasa Indonesia to Javanese. Learn how they shape culture, identity, and daily life in this rich archipelago.
-
Bali Street Food: A Complete Guide to Culinary Delights
Discover the ultimate guide to Bali street food! Explore must-try dishes, vegan options, top spots, and sustainable dining tips for a flavorful island adventure.
-
Bali Local Transport & Taxi Guide: Best Ways to Get Around
Discover the best transport options in Bali! Learn about taxis, scooters, Grab, Gojek, private drivers, and how to avoid scams while getting around safely.